gbnn90
?>

Ошибка program1.pas(5) : нельзя преобразовать тип real к integer. можете объяснить почему? program chasiki; var n, z, x, y, v, b : real; begin read (n); z: =n div 3600; x: =n mod 3600; y: =x div 60; v: =y mod 60; b: =v mod 60; writeln (z, x, b); end.

Информатика

Ответы

kostavaani
z:=N div 3600; - операция div применима только к целочисленным типам, а у Вас объявлено var N ... :real;
eronch
Дело в том, что div и mod - относятся к операциям на ЦЕЛЫМИ числами, Вы же пытаетесь их использовать с вещественными.
Div - Целая часть от деления, а Mod - остаток
Для типа Real следует использовать "/"
Allahverdi_Мария475
Pascal:
const n = 10;
var a:array [1..n] of integer;
     i,max,c:integer;
begin
 clrscr;
 readln (a[1]);
 max:=a[1];
 c:=1;
 for i:=2 to n do
  begin
   readln (a[i]);
   if a[i]>max then
    begin
     max:=a[i];
     c:=1;
    end
    else if a[i]=max then inc(c);
  end;
 writeln ('Kol-vo: ',c);
end.

C++:
#include <iostream>
using namespace std;

int main()
{
  int a[10];
  int c = 0,max;
  cin >>a[0];
  max = a[0];
  for (int i = 1; i<10; i++)
  {
    cin >>a[i];
    if (a[i]>max)
    {
      max = a[i];
      c = 1;
    }
    else if (a[i]==max)
             ++c;
  }
  cout <<"KOL_VO: " <<c <<endl;
  return 0;
}
fedoseevgleb

Объяснение:

1) Виды локальных сетей?

Локальные сети бывают одноранговыми и с выделенным сервером.

2)Специальная плата компьютера для передачи и приёма сигналов,

распространяемых по каналам связи - это...

сетевой адаптер

3)Если два компьютера связаны между собой через Wi-Fi соединение, то можно назвать это компьютерной сетью?

Да

4)Скорость передачи данных по каналу связи равна 512 бит в секунду. Сколько  

секунд будет передаваться через это соединение файл размером 10

Килобайт?

160 секунд

5)Как называется организация, предоставляющая пользователям связь с

глобальной сетью?

Провайдер

Ответить на вопрос

Поделитесь своими знаниями, ответьте на вопрос:

Ошибка program1.pas(5) : нельзя преобразовать тип real к integer. можете объяснить почему? program chasiki; var n, z, x, y, v, b : real; begin read (n); z: =n div 3600; x: =n mod 3600; y: =x div 60; v: =y mod 60; b: =v mod 60; writeln (z, x, b); end.
Ваше имя (никнейм)*
Email*
Комментарий*

Популярные вопросы в разделе

Galina3241
Allahverdi_Мария475
Sergei1805
Sergei
severbykova
adminaa
oshemkov579
Попов1946
xsmall1
KonovalovKonstantinovna1306
Serkova_Elena251
samuilik-v
Irina Svetlana
samuilik-v
ekvld708